Founded in 1996, Mister Sparky® of Atlanta has been delivering dependable and professional electrical services to the Atlanta region. Over the years, our mission has remained steadfast: to provide superior electrical repairs, installations, and maintenance while focusing on outstanding customer service. We’ve learned that the secret to customer satisfaction lies in merging quality work with exceptional service, establishing us as a trusted group of electricians in Atlanta.

Had a Mr Sparky guy come out to look at a light fixture that had unexpectedly gone out about the same time as a dreadful, unidentifiable chemical smell had started up in our new house, a smell that had left many contractors of various types stumped, and had made one poor HVAC guy vomit, repeatedly, on my lawn. We only called Mr Sparky because it was an emergency, and not that many people answer the phone at 7pm at night.
Spoiler: the fixture wasn't the culprit, not even tangentially related. The Mr Sparky electrician presumably realized this quickly, because he immediately moved to telling me my breaker box was about to burn the house down. He backed this up by pulling up all sorts of scaremongering videos on his iPad for me to watch, and articles which basically said, ""yes, you're about to die, omg.""
What he didn't do was actually check the box. Which we'd had another electrician do at an earlier date: every single breaker in that box had been replaced since its initial installation, and had been recently tested. It was perfectly safe.
I told the Mr Sparky guy to write me a quote in an effort to get rid of him... which he did. He padded it with at least four other things I did not want and we had not discussed. His quote came to $5000, and it was still another ten or fifteen minutes til I managed to turf him out.
We got our regular electrician to quote us the same work (plus a few extra things)... and he'll do it for about 1/5th the cost. Funny, the HVAC guy had warned me about Mr Sparky. ""They'll try to rip you off!""
He was right.
